What is the Gift Giving Program?
During the holidays, families can’t always fulfill items on their wish list when they have to balance other expenses like rent, food, gas, childcare, and more. But there are ways that we as a community can help. Participants in YWCA’s Gift Giving Program are matched with a specific family and receive details such as the family’s size, interests, ages, and which stores the children would like gift cards to. Gift cards received for these programs are distributed to families in our shelters across King and Snohomish Counties.
Our families receive gift cards so they can have personal agency to purchase culturally responsive foods for their holidays and gifts that best meet their families’ needs. Since transitioning to a gift-card model in 2020, our program participants have provided incredible feedback about how empowered shopping for their families themselves has made them feel.
Deep and Powerful Community Support
In 2024, through the generosity of our donors, we were able to give gift cards to over 450 families and over 1,000 children. One of the partners that stands with us this holiday season is The Burnsteads. A local family of independent home building companies, The Burnsteads have been committed to the Pacific Northwest for over 50 years. Their ongoing commitment to stewardship is at the foundation of the neighborhoods they build, and that commitment shows with their generous investment in YWCA.

In 2024, The Burnsteads supported 100 families in the Gift Giving program and since then, their commitment has only deepened. They’re volunteers at our Angeline’s Day Center; a proud sponsor of YWCA’s Inspire Luncheon, our annual fundraiser that supports women and families in YWCA’s programs; and have renewed their commitment to Gift Giving program, ensuring the power of choice for our families as they shop this holiday season.
